A three-year relationship between Wakatipu High and a Tahitian college strengthened last week.

For the first time, Wakatipu High year 11 and 12 French language students and their families home-hosted the 26 students from French-speaking Tahiti's College of the Sacre-Coeur.

The visiting students shared their culture and identity through traditional dance performances (left) and, due to their Polynesian culture, also came together with Wakatipu High School’s kapa haka group and its Pasifika students.

They also undertook various tourism attractions during their nine-day visit.

In September, 11 year 12 Wakatipu High School French language students will travel to Tahiti and Moorea to reconnect with the same students and their families.
